The instructions to modify the json files are missing. (Using find and sed to
change all instances of v4_4_ to v4_3_ before importing them into Grafana)
This is from an Oracle Blog on the doing this with OLVM 4.3 (which is basically
a repackaged oVirt 4.3)

If it's already enabled there's no need to run it again. I looked at
the doc again now, and it's slightly outdated, since 4.4.8 we add the
required openstack (victoria) and ceph repos automatically
